The nose of an ultralight plane is pointed south, and its airspeed indicator shows 35 m/s. The plane is in a 10-m/s wind blowing toward the southwest relative to the earth.
(a) In a vector addition diagram, show the relationship of \(\vec{v}_{P / E}\) (the velocity of the plane relative to the earth) to the two given vectors.
(b) Letting 𝑥 be east and 𝑦 be north, find the components of \(\vec{v}_{P / E}\).
(c) Find the magnitude and direction of \(\vec{v}_{P / E}\).
